1. If you have not done so already, remove the major

parts of the kit from the box (wing halves, fuselage, tail
parts, etc.) and inspect them for damage. If any parts are
damaged or missing, contact Product Support at the
address or telephone number listed on the front cover.

2. Remove the masking tape and separate the ailerons

from the wing, the rudder from the fin and the elevator from
the stabilizer. With a covering sock on your covering iron, set
the temperature to high and tighten the covering, if
necessary. Apply pressure over sheeted areas to thoroughly
bond the covering to the wood. Hint: Poke three or four pin
holes in the covering between the “ribs” in the tail surfaces.
This will allow the hot air to escape while tightening the
covering.

1. Drill a 3/32" [2.3mm] hole, 1/2" [12.7mm] deep in

the center of each hinge slot to allow the CA to “wick” in.
Follow-up with a #11 blade to clean-out the slots. Hint: If
you have one, use a high-speed rotary tool to drill the holes.

❏ ❏

2. Use a sharp #11 blade to cut a strip of covering

from the hinge slots in the wing and aileron.

❏ ❏

3. Test fit the ailerons to the wing with the hinges. If

the hinges don’t stay centered, stick a pin through the
middle of the hinge to hold it in position.

❏ ❏

4. Clean the aileron torque rod with denatured alcohol

to remove any contaminants.

❏ ❏

5. Mix up a small amount of 6-minute epoxy. Using a

toothpick, apply epoxy in the aileron torque rod hole and
along the groove in the leading edge of the aileron. Before
the epoxy cures, install the aileron on the wing. Remove any
pins you may have inserted into the hinges. Adjust the
aileron so there is a small gap between the LE of the aileron
and the wing. The gap should be small – just enough to see
light through or to slip a piece of paper through.
